The council voted on multiple agenda items Feb. 4, 2026, approving consent items and adopting an ordinance to collect medical-debt data intended to identify who is billed and denied assistance.

The Los Angeles City Council conducted votes on Feb. 4, 2026 after a ceremonial program for Black History Month. The council recorded a quorum and approved the minutes and several consent items; later roll call votes were taken and the clerk announced "14 a favor" for the items on the agenda.
